Understanding Audrena's Visual Personality

Audrena presents itself with a graceful, flowing rhythm. The characters are well-balanced, with smooth lines that create a sense of movement without sacrificing legibility. What sets it apart from many handwritten fonts is its varying baseline—this subtle natural variation gives text an organic, authentic feel, as if written by a skilled hand rather than generated by a machine. The gorgeous glyphs and stunning alternates provide creative flexibility, allowing designers to customize letterforms for different contexts.

Practical Guidance for Working with Audrena

Choosing any premium font involves more than simply liking how it looks. Here are practical considerations for getting the most from Audrena:

Evaluating Project Fit

Before committing, consider your project's specific needs. Audrena works best when you need elegance and personality in display contexts—headlines, logos, short phrases, and accent text. It's generally not designed for extended body copy, where readability at small sizes becomes challenging for most handwritten fonts.

Testing Font Pairings

Font pairing is where Audrena truly comes alive. Try combining it with a clean sans serif font like Montserrat or a classic serif font like Lora for contrast. The handwritten style pairs naturally with structured, geometric typefaces, creating visual tension that feels balanced rather than chaotic. Always test pairings in context—what works on a mood board might need adjustment in your actual layout.

Reviewing Included Styles and Alternates

Audrena features gorgeous alternates that can transform the look of your text. Take time to explore these options in your design software. Swapping alternate characters for key letters in headlines or logos can add extra distinction and prevent your work from looking generic.

Readability Considerations

Even the most beautiful font fails if people can't read it. Test Audrena at the sizes you'll actually use. For digital applications, check rendering across different devices and screen sizes. For print, proof at actual output dimensions. The flowing baseline and connected letterforms are part of its charm, but they require adequate sizing to remain legible.
